3. Sneak is what you use to go by undetected (and backstab), security is the art of opening locks and disarming traps, acrobatics that of jumping high and far (useful when you must escape, mercantile the art of selling high whatever you stole and buying low whatever you cannot steal. These are basic requirements for a thief.
Then you need a weapon proficiency (I suggest long blade), and an armor skill (I sugegst light, allows you to carry more loot).
Hand to hand and speechcraft aren't that important, so I suggest you build your own sneak oriented custom adventurer instead of choosing the built-in thief class. This way you can choose two other more useful skills (suggestion: mysticism, athletics)
